GlaxoSmithKline in Greater London is seeking a qualified professional to undertake signal detection and evaluation activities for assigned products. The ideal candidate will hold an advanced degree (MD, DO, or MBBS), demonstrate strong analytical thinking, effective communication skills, and have a commitment to high performance quality standards.

Responsibilities include supporting safety governance and preparing detailed evaluations on major GSK products.

Preferred qualifications include additional medical or scientific training and prior experience in pharmacovigilance.
